Full-color active-matrix organic light-emitting diode display on human skin based on a large-area MoS2 backplane.
TL;DR: The consistent and controlled functioning of a large-area full-color OLED display with a MoS2 backplane was demonstrated and the ultrathin device substrate allowed for integration of the display on an unusual substrate, namely, a human hand.

Stretchable Electroluminescent Display Enabled by Graphene-Based Hybrid Electrode.
Heechang Shin,Bhupendra K. Sharma,Seung Won Lee,Jae Bok Lee,Minwoo Choi,Luhing Hu,Cheolmin Park,Jin Hwan Choi,Tae Woong Kim,Jong Hyun Ahn +9 more
TL;DR: The developed hybrid electrode overcomes the limitations of commonly known metallic NWs and ionic conductor-based electrodes for ACEL applications and the potential of the hybrid electrode is realized in demonstrating large-area stretchable ACEL devices composed of an 8 × 8 passive array.

Flexible micro-LED display and its application in Gbps multi-channel visible light communication
Luhing Hu,Jae Yong Choi,Sumin Hwangbo,Do Hoon Kwon,Bongkyun Jang,Seunghyeon Ji,Jae-Hyun Kim,Sang-Kook Han,Jong Hyun Ahn +8 more
TL;DR: In this paper , a flexible full-color micro-LED display with high mechanical robustness was fabricated by printing quantum dots (QDs) on a blue micro LED array using standard photolithography.
